Compliance context

AB 802 (Public Resources Code §25402.10)

AB 802 requires every California commercial building over 50,000 sq ft to report energy use to the CEC annually; the CEC publicly discloses the results statewide.

Frequently asked questions

What is Us-Sfo-Twn510's energy grade?

Us-Sfo-Twn510 scores 91 out of 100 on ENERGY STAR — band A (High performer (85–100)) — in its 2024 California disclosure. Scores are national percentiles against similar buildings; 75+ qualifies for ENERGY STAR certification.

How much energy does Us-Sfo-Twn510 use?

Its 2024 site energy-use intensity was 30.5 kBtu/ft² across 249,831 sq ft, including 2,100,465 kWh of electricity and 4,515 therms of natural gas.
